## Slimtainer: Limits & Quotas

Hey plugin folks — before you wire your slimming plugin into Slimtainer, know the guardrails. We cap how many layers your plugin can rewrite per pass, how big a single layer diff can get, and how long your hook may run before we kill it. Blow past these and the build fails with a quota error, not a warning, so budget accordingly. If you genuinely need more headroom, file a request with the Parbeck build team. The enforced defaults are below.

constants for tageg-kagag:
QUOTAS = {
    "kelax": 495,
    "istath": 366,
    "tammir": 108,
    "novdor": 730,
    "casax": 816,
    "quenael": 874,
    "pelius": 403,
}

Memo — Second-Source Supplier Search

For the incoming director: Renholt Fabrication remains our sole supplier of valve housings. Risk unacceptable. Procurement has shortlisted three alternatives: Maskell Industries, Torvane Metals, and Ostreth Works. Site audits scheduled this quarter. Target: qualified second source within six months, dual sourcing at 70/30 split thereafter. Budget approved. Decisions rest with you after audits conclude. The confidential plan summary follows below.

board note of kageg-bahof: The renewal with Holwynax Holdings closes at $2 million a year, 5 percent below the last contract. Project Ulaath slips by two quarters because of the supplier delay.

At 11:47 the nightly run of the Glimmertext extraction script silently omitted all pluralized translation keys from the generated catalog. Root cause was a regex change merged the prior evening that failed to match the new plural-block syntax, and the script exits zero even when extraction yields an empty group. Downstream, the Veldra localization pipeline shipped fallback English strings to three locales before detection. Reviewers should note the script lacks a key-count regression check. The implicated build is recorded immediately below.

trace token, fafog-kageg: htk4_98e6